Cut your skinned salmon fillet into large cubes and add to a bowl.
Blend together chipotle peppers, lime juice, garlic, olive oil, honey, and salt until smooth.
Cover salmon cubes with marinade, cover bowl with plastic wrap, and sit in refrigerator for at least 1 hour or overnight.
Grill, bake, or air-fry marinated salmon cubes until browned and fully cooked. Set aside.
For slaw, mix mayonnaise, lime juice, honey, and salt into small bowl.
Add cabbage slaw mix and chopped cilantro, mix until fully combined. Let sit until softened (note: the longer the slaw sits in the slaw sauce the softer it gets)
Serve honey chipotle salmon on toasted flour tortillas with cilantro lime slaw, fresh cilantro, avocados, and lime wedges for garnish.
